First off, I am new to Linux (been using about six months) in general, and even newer to Hylafax. I have managed to get Hylafax working decently with a Multi-Tech modem under Mandriva LE 2005, sending and receiving faxes. I am having a small problem in the file conversion to PDF. When I try to open the PDF file in Windows, I get an error saying the PDF is corrupt. The .tiff file works fine.

Now comes the harder part (I think). Our phone system (NEC Aspire) is compatible with DID and our service provider can supply me with the required DID numbers and system programming to use DID routing for our companies faxes. I am looking at the Multi-Tech Systems MT5634ZBA-DID modem to use for this function. I have searched the archives and can only find posts as recent as 2003 regarding Hylafax and DID support. Does Hylafax support fax routing by DID numbers? If so, can someone point me in the right direction for instructions on setting Hylaxfax up for this.
